On Thu,  7 Apr 2022 12:28:47 +0200 Jakob Koschel wrote:
> diff --git a/drivers/net/dsa/sja1105/sja1105_vl.c b/drivers/net/dsa/sja1105/sja1105_vl.c
> index b7e95d60a6e4..cfcae4d19eef 100644
> --- a/drivers/net/dsa/sja1105/sja1105_vl.c
> +++ b/drivers/net/dsa/sja1105/sja1105_vl.c
> @@ -27,20 +27,24 @@ static int sja1105_insert_gate_entry(struct sja1105_gating_config *gating_cfg,
>  	if (list_empty(&gating_cfg->entries)) {
>  		list_add(&e->list, &gating_cfg->entries);
>  	} else {
> -		struct sja1105_gate_entry *p;
> +		struct sja1105_gate_entry *p = NULL, *iter;
>  
> -		list_for_each_entry(p, &gating_cfg->entries, list) {
> -			if (p->interval == e->interval) {
> +		list_for_each_entry(iter, &gating_cfg->entries, list) {
> +			if (iter->interval == e->interval) {
>  				NL_SET_ERR_MSG_MOD(extack,
>  						   "Gate conflict");
>  				rc = -EBUSY;
>  				goto err;
>  			}
>  
> -			if (e->interval < p->interval)
> +			if (e->interval < iter->interval) {
> +				p = iter;
> +				list_add(&e->list, iter->list.prev);
>  				break;
> +			}
>  		}
> -		list_add(&e->list, p->list.prev);
> +		if (!p)
> +			list_add(&e->list, gating_cfg->entries.prev);

This turns a pretty slick piece of code into something ugly :(
I'd rather you open coded the iteration here than make it more 
complex to satisfy "safe coding guidelines".

Also the list_add() could be converted to list_add_tail().
